The largest of Warringah's four coastal lagoons, Narrabeen Lagoon facilitates a range of activities in company with the northern beaches. If a swim in the lagoon doesn't meet your standards of adventures, locals and visitors alike enjoy kayaking, sailing and paddle boarding or a move to the surrounding parkland for bushwalking or a picnic in the sun. The vast North Narrabeen Rockpool can be accessed by Narrabeen Park Parade at the entrance of the lagoon. A distinctive boardwalk separates the 70 metre by 40 metre pool from the 60 metre by 50 metre wading pool.
